Quote:
Originally Posted by pbz06 View Post
Yes to your first question.

What I would do for testing, find a nice scene with high APL and high color luminance. Disable DV so you are in HDR10, and pause it at that scene. Make sure for now all your 820 settings are default and have HDR Optimizer "on". I'd use the OLED setting first though, and then toggle HDR Optimier on vs off so you can see the differences. I bet with "on", you'll have more of a restored color saturation than with "off". You can then play with your LG DTM setting and see how it affects it, and then compare with "high luminance".

Then! try DV again to compare how each setting is close or different.
Thanks for the advice! I followed your steps and I figured out the saturation issue. It was the HDR Optimizer setting on my Panny 820.

I didn't realize those settings actually messed with saturation. I thought they were all about getting more highlight detail out of the picture. I have it set to the OLED setting now. I still have LG's DTM setting "On" as well, as I believe it adds the necessary saturation. I'm now messing with the slider to figure out the best setting for that.

But overall, this fixes my issues and now the saturation is exactly where it needs to be. Again, it surprises me that those settings for the HDR optimizer messes with saturation. Thanks again!

Quote:
Originally Posted by chip75 View Post
Having a message about disc errors wouldn't be a handshake issue. Did they test the player in front of you? can you try it on another TV?

I wouldn't expect to have a resume feature after powering down, as it's specific to certain discs that don't use Java. Try a disc that you know that has the feature to see if you have issues.
Thanks for your reply.

I know that every studio has their own protocol when it comes to discs resuming. Sony discs for example ask if you want to resume yes or no (same as criterion), whereas other studios allow the disc to pick up automatically when you press play from startup and Paramount discs require you to bookmark where you left off. I have around 600 4k discs now, so am well versed with the way different discs work from startup.

I’ve tried multiple discs from multiple studios and have the same issue.

The place I took the player back to showed me on their TVs, but this wasn’t from startup and they weren’t 4k TVs (I.e. I have the problem when everything is turned off and Viera link is on, I.e. me pressing play on the Panasonic UB820 remote sends the signal to also turn on the TV).

The disc read error then won’t clear regardless of me changing settings etc, but it’s only resolved regardless of disc by me when reading eject and closing the tray again to play.

I haven’t tried on another TV yet - I do have an older Sony X900F in the bedroom.
